new XUIEnergyConsumptionBarLine()
Methods
-
AddBarByName(strName)
-
添加柱状图
Parameters:
Name Type Description strName
String 柱状图名称 Properties:
Name Type Description BarName
String "firstBar" -
AddDataArr(strCategory, arrValue)
-
设置数据
Parameters:
Name Type Description strCategory
String 数据名称 arrValue
Array 数值 -
AddDataByName(strName, xName, yValue)
-
添加数据
Parameters:
Name Type Description strName
String 图形名称 xName
String x轴类别 yValue
Number 数值 -
AddLineByName(strName)
-
添加折线
Parameters:
Name Type Description strName
String 折线名称 Properties:
Name Type Description LineName
String "firstLine" -
AddXAxisLableData(strLabel)
-
添加x轴数据
Parameters:
Name Type Description strLabel
String 标签数据 -
RemoveAllBar()
-
清空所有柱状图
-
RemoveAllLine()
-
清空所有线
-
RemoveXAxisLableData()
-
清空x轴数据
-
SetCumulativeEnergy(nCumulativeEnergy)
-
设置累计能耗
Parameters:
Name Type Description nCumulativeEnergy
Number 设置累计能耗 -
SetDailyEnergy(nDailyEnergy)
-
设置当日能耗
Parameters:
Name Type Description nDailyEnergy
Number 当日能耗数据 -
SetLabelDisplay(Num)
-
设置x轴标签一行显示几个字
Parameters:
Name Type Description Num
Number 数值 Properties:
Name Type Description Value
Number 5 -
SetXAxisLabelInterval(NumValue)
-
设置x轴类别显示间隔
Parameters:
Name Type Description NumValue
Number 数值 Properties:
Name Type Description IntervalValue
Number 4 -
SetXAxisLableData(ArrLabel)
-
设置x轴数据
Parameters:
Name Type Description ArrLabel
Array 标签数据 Properties:
Name Type Description XAxisLableData
Array ["10/11周一", "10/12周二", "10/13周三", "10/14周四", "10/15周五", "10/16周六", "10/17周日"]